I stand behind the craftsmanship and durability of every piece I create. I design them carefully with longevity in mind, and I hand-assemble them to last decades. Thus, I am proud to offer a 15-year limited warranty to give you peace of mind.

What This Warranty Covers:

  • Structural integrity of the piece, including clasps, and fastenings.
  • Defects in materials or workmanship under normal use.
  • Replacement of lost or detached stones, beads, or crystals under normal use.
  • Repairs or replacements, at my discretion, for issues arising from covered defects.

     

What This Warranty Does Not Cover:

  • Normal wear and tear, including scratches, plating loss, or tarnishing.
  • Breakage, damage, or loss caused by accident, misuse, or neglect.
  • Alterations or repairs performed by anyone other than The Crystal Smyth.
  • Replacement of lost or detached stones, beads, or crystals due to accidental damage.

Care & Maintenance:
To keep your piece in the best condition, I recommend gentle handling, avoiding submerging your piece in water, spraying it with excessive perfume, or any harsh chemicals, and storing it in a soft pouch or box when not in use. Following these guidelines will help extend the life of your pieces and preserve your warranty.

How to Make a Warranty Claim:
If you experience an issue with your piece, please contact me at Hello@CrystalSmyth.com with your contact information, photos of your piece, and a description of the issue. I’ll review your claim and arrange for repair, replacement, or other resolution. The customer is responsible for shipping the item back; return shipping of repaired/replaced items will be covered by me.

Duration:
This warranty is valid for fifteen (15) years from the original date of purchase.

The process of creating my pieces is complex, yet ensures the finest quality, durability and allows maximum customization.

Each design begins as a concept sketch, which I turn into a CAD drawing. I then laser cut the Lucite and metals required to produce the piece in house.

The cut parts are hand-assembled, polished, and the crystals are set. After a further polishing step, the piece is ready to be shipped to its new owner.

I work in a wide range of exotic woods, metals and plastics. Much of my jewelry is created in Lucite backed with a vacuum-metalized mirror and sealed with a scratch-resistant coating. The end result is as reflective as a glass mirror, whilst being shatter-resistant and half the weight of glass, yet 17 times stronger.

Metals are used to create the bases of crowns and scepters. I mostly work in aluminum, stainless steel and gold-plated brass.

90% of each design is made of custom parts cut and assembled in my Denver, Colorado studio. Unless otherwise specified, the crystals you see in my work are top quality Czech or Austrian crystal.
